Dancing with the stars – Week 2 Week 2 of Dancing with the stars consisted of absolute and utter brilliance from all the contestants compared to the average week 1 performance from them. Ballroom dancing, Latin dancing and Waltz are one of my favorite genres of dancing and I’ve watched and practiced Waltz myself for the past couple of years so I can quite fairly say when there’s a good performance or a bad performance. And honestly, I found most of the couples did an exceptional job this week. I felt they all worked harder and put their 110% on the stage because after week 1 they know impressing the 3 judges is no easy task! And hopefully they all continue the same performance as this week and don’t slack off. Even though I mentioned that all of them did a brilliant job; I did think that one of the couple were just par. I felt Derek and Sharna were that couple this week and could definitely improve next week onwards. After watching mostly all the couples perform some spectacular dance routines in week 2, I just automatically expected more as the show went on. Derek and Sharna came in towards the end and I just needed more from them. They didn’t really have me in awe like how the other couples did. Derek and Sharna performed a Foxtrot dance routine which wasn’t horrible but at the same time it wasn’t that great or catchy for me. Their dance routine was way too slow and a bit boring to be honest. I kind of just wanted it to get over. Their moves were a bit off and definitely not synchronized. I felt Derek got a bit nervous (probably because of his mom being in the audience) and started slowing down on his pace towards the middle of their routine. But even with all that going on I think Sharna did a good job. For me, Nikki Bella and Artem Chigvintsev’s Waltz routine just simply took my breath away. I think they are definitely a couple to look out for this season! I feel that their chemistry is

out of this world and they clearly showed it this week with their glamorous Waltz performance. Nikki Bella, coming out from a very rough and fierce background due to her WWE career, really surprised me with her beautiful and glamorous performance with Artem. Seeing her dance and float like a butterfly so comfortably just had me in awe. And Artem supporting her and having her back really paved the way for her. They definitely are one of the power couples this season. Hence, I have them as my best couple this week. Can’t wait for week 3!...
